WebHighland is the only area to adopt the lead agency arrangement. In this arrangement, the chief executive of the lead agency has responsibility to develop the strategic plan. NHS Highland has responsibility for adult health and social care services and Highland Council has responsibility for children’s health and social care services. BODY CORPORATE

When the Integration Authority has been formed using the Body Corporate model, the Integration Joint Board (IJB) has overall governance responsibility for the Integration Authority. The membership of the IJB is made up of voting and non-voting members. cancer cluster houston mapWebHSCP Chief Officer: providing operational leadership Support and role .
